One common sign of a rigged game is unusually consistent losses despite employing sound strategies or odds that seem heavily skewed against the player. When game outcomes defy statistical probabilities over a significant period, it may indicate manipulation. Additionally, software glitches, delayed payouts, or errors in gameplay mechanics can be red flags. Players should also verify if the casino is licensed and regulated by reputable authorities, which enforce strict oversight to prevent game rigging. Independent audits and certifications by third-party testing agencies can further ensure fairness.
